#151982 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#151982 is composed of 8.2% red, 9.8%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.8% cyan, 80.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 237.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 29.6%. #151982 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a32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

Shades and Tints of #151982

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02020c is the darkest color, while #fafaf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#151982

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#49494e is the less saturated color, while #040993 is the most saturated one.
